81307600005 MAN

Brand Part number Description Days Statistics Price, USD Availability
MAN 81307600005 25
22.70 10
Show more
Automega 120026010 10
3.13 > 5
20
4.26 5
31
5.40 1000
56
3.90 6
Show more
FTE 395430E1 7
7.82 1
270
7.19 3
Show more
Meyle 1006110054 30
1098.90 15
80
1055.76 > 10
50
1098.90 > 10
Show more
Brand Price
Automega 3.13
FTE 7.19
MAN 22.70
Meyle 1055.76